'The Beauty Inside' takes inspiration from both the 2015 South Korean film of the same name and the original American film. However, the drama expands upon the concept, offering a richer and more detailed exploration of its central premise. This Korean drama masterfully blends fantasy, romance, and drama, creating a viewing experience that is both heartwarming and thought-provoking. The series follows Han Se-gye, a top actress, and Seo Do-jae, an intelligent executive. The catch? Se-gye experiences a bizarre phenomenon where she transforms into a different person for a week each month, and Do-jae has prosopagnosia, which means he can't recognize faces. This setup provides the foundation for a compelling story about love and connection, as both characters struggle with their individual challenges while also navigating their relationship.

Then, there's the masterful execution. The acting is phenomenal, the cinematography is stunning, and the soundtrack is absolutely unforgettable. The cast, led by Seo Hyun-jin as Han Se-gye and Lee Min-ki as Seo Do-jae, delivers powerful performances that bring these complex characters to life. Their chemistry is electric, and you can't help but root for them as they navigate their unique relationship. The supporting cast is equally impressive, adding depth and humor to the story.
